All subscriptions are due before the Opening Meet and should be sent to the Secretary with cheques payable to 'Tedworth Hunt'. A 5% discount will apply to subscriptions paid by 1st August.
Field money for mounted hound exercise and Autumn Hunting up to 30th September will be £10 and from the 1st October will be £20 (half prices for under 18s). There will be no field money due for those that have paid their subscription.
Full subscribers employee's may hunt on the subscriber's horse by prior arrangement with the Secretary and are entitled to ask one guest per season at no cost.
All visitors must notify the Secretary prior to the day's hunting.
Vouchers must be handed to the secretary prior to day's hunting.
All children under 14 must be accompanied by a mounted adult
